Sam Curran Facts

  1. He was raised alongside his older brothers Ben and Tom Curran in Northampton, England.
  2. Tom Curran was the only one born in Cape Town, Western Cape, South Africa.
  3. Sam was raised in a family of passionate cricketers. His father Kevin played internationally for Zimbabwe and his grandfather Kevin Patrick Curran played for Rhodesia.
  4. Sam resided on a farm with his family in Rusape, Zimbabwe until it was seized by the government in 2004.
  5. He is a left-handed batsman and left-arm medium-fast bowler.
  6. Sam played for the Surrey County Cricket Club at the “Under-15”, “Under-17”, and “Second XI Championship”.
  7. In 2014, Sam played for Weybridge in the “Surrey Championship Premier Division”.
  8. Former cricketer Alec Stewart was very taken up with how Curran played when he was 17 years old.
  9. On June 19, 2015, Curran played his first Twenty20 match against Kent at The Oval. A month later, he played his debut first-class match against the same team at a County Championship.
  10. He contributed his skills to the “Auckland Aces” for the 2017–18 Super Smash.
  11. Sam was named on the England Test team on May 30, 2018, as a replacement to Ben Stokes and played his first debut match on June 1 that year at the Headingley Cricket Ground.
  12. In December 2018, Sam the Kings XI Punjab bought him at an astonishing INR 7.20 crore for the 2019 Indian Premier League.
  13. Sam played his first One Day International match against Australia on June 24, 2018.
  14. He was one of the people that were announced as the International Cricket Council’s must-watch players.
  15. Sam was chosen by the Wisden Cricketers’ Almanack 2019 edition of their Wisden Cricketers of the Year.
  16. During his stint with the Kings XI Punjab in 2018, he was named the youngest player to take a hat-trick in the IPL.
  17. At the 2020 Indian Premier League, he was auctioned out to the Chennai Super Kings.

On December 23, 2022, Sam Curran became the most expensive buy in IPL history (the record was broken in IPL 2024) when he was bought by Punjab Kings (PBKS) for INR 18.5 crore (or INR 185 million) for IPL 2023. His base price was INR 2 crore. A total of 6 teams had bid for him. Before him, the previous record was held by Chris Morris when he was purchased by Rajasthan Royals for INR 16.25 crore in 2021.
